Docker engine crash when building using a new builder (with docker-container driver)

Open vnmabus opened this issue 10 months ago • 1 comments

Description

When I build a moderately complex Docker project (~2Gb), using a new builder, the build stops at the "sending tarball" step. After a while Docker Desktop shows that the Docker engine has stopped (crashed?).

This happened after I upgraded Docker Desktop from version 4.34.3-170107 to 4.38.0-181591 (the same project was working before just fine).

Reproduce

I have a custom builder created as follows:

docker buildx create --use --name kk

Then I try to build and load my project:

docker buildx build -t <my_tag> --load .

It builds and stops in "sending tarball". After a while the Docker Desktop program informs that the engine is stopped.

The error is stochastic in nature: it usually happens but there is a (very) small chance it won't. It also does not happen when using a simple project (e.g., one which just creates a couple files). It also won't happen with the default driver (as in that case one does not use --load).

Expected behavior

The build should run successfully.
